A wonderful 1958 edition of Scrabble for Juniors, produced by J. W. Spear & Sons in England. A beautiful example of mid-century children’s game design, rich with colour, illustration, and that unmistakable midcentury optimism for learning through play.
The double-sided board features charming pictorial letter tiles - animals, everyday objects, and playful motifs, designed to help young players build words visually as well as phonetically. The graphics are bold and joyful, with a soft, time-worn palette that feels as appealing today as it would have done spread out on a living room floor in the late 1950s.
Complete with its original box, instruction leaflet, and wooden letter tiles, this set is as much a nostalgic object as it is a game. Whether played, displayed, or simply treasured, it speaks to slower afternoons, shared tables, and the quiet rituals of family life.

Details:
- Dated 1958
- Made in England by J. W. Spear & Sons
- Original box, board, tiles, and instructions
- Illustrated junior learning board with pictorial tiles
- Age-related wear consistent with use and age
